Cyclists are particularly vulnerable on the roads, as they lack the protection of a vehicle and are harder for drivers to see. Lorries have large blind spots, especially on the sides and rear of the vehicle, which can make it difficult for drivers to spot cyclists. This can lead to dangerous situations where cyclists are unable to avoid collisions with lorries. In fact, lorries are involved in a disproportionately high number of accidents involving cyclists.

To address this issue, various measures have been implemented to improve Lorry Cyclist protection. One such measure is the installation of blind spot detection systems on lorries. These systems use cameras or sensors to monitor the areas around the lorry that are difficult for drivers to see. When a cyclist enters a blind spot, the system alerts the driver, helping to prevent accidents. Some systems can even automatically apply the brakes if a collision is imminent.

Legislation has also played a role in improving lorry cyclist protection. Some cities and countries have implemented laws that require lorries to be equipped with certain safety features, such as side guards and sensors. Side guards are panels that are fitted to the sides of lorries to prevent cyclists from being dragged underneath in the event of a collision. Sensors can detect when a cyclist is in close proximity to the lorry and alert the driver. These requirements help to reduce the risk of accidents and improve the safety of cyclists sharing the road with lorries.
